Manchester United Pursuing PSG's Xavi Simons for Attack Reinforcement

Manchester United is setting its sights on bolstering its attacking prowess going into the new season, with the club expressing a keen interest in Paris Saint-Germain's promising young winger, Xavi Simons.

Discussions between Manchester United and PSG have already kicked off, laying the groundwork for what could be a significant acquisition. PSG has made it clear that any deal for Simons will come with stipulations. The French giants are demanding a guarantee fee, and they are open to the possibility of initially loaning Simons to the English side, but with an obligation to buy down the line. The fee required for the 20-year-old dynamo is estimated to be in the range of €60-70 million.

Competition for Simons

Manchester United isn't the only club eyeing the Dutch winger. Bayern Munich and RB Leipzig are also in the hunt. It's reported that Bayern Munich has already agreed to terms with Simons, indicating the Bundesliga's reigning champions are serious contenders in this transfer battle. Notably, Simons spent last season on loan at RB Leipzig, where he had an impressive campaign, notching up 10 goals and 15 assists.

Simons' time at Leipzig has been pivotal for his development, and it's evident he has formed a strong bond with the club. His performances have not gone unnoticed, and this has likely spurred the interest from multiple top-tier European clubs.
